DevOps Engineer at Astute - The Financial Services Exchange4.5I use Flowgear for data ingestion, transformation, and API exposure, simplifying data mapping from any format. Its integration feature saves time, completing processes within a day. Satisfied with its performance, no improvements are needed, and ROI is fast.
DevOps Engineer at Astute5.0We use Flowgear for data transformation across our environments, benefiting from its low-code features and pre-connectors. It simplifies deployment and error correction, though lacks options for SMEs and better training environments. Overall, it boosts our efficiency.
Team Lead: Solution Developer at Genasys Technologies (Pty) Ltd5.0Flowgear has streamlined my team's automation workflows by enabling seamless integration with various systems, saving development time. While some improvements are needed in navigation and timeout settings, it offers better features than Microsoft SSIS with efficient, secure connectors.
Business Development Consultant at Inhance4.5We integrate operational supply chain systems into ERPs using Flowgear's no-code platform, which simplifies integration with pre-built nodes. Improvement is needed in self-help tools and examples. Flowgear provides a better ROI than in-house solutions we've previously used.
Cloud Architect at Astute - The Financial Services Exchange5.0I use Flowgear to map and transform data for our applications, appreciating its easy customization and onboarding. It effectively integrates nodes securely, and while improvements are always possible, its extensive integrations make it highly attractive. No alternatives were considered.
CX Specialist at Adapt IT4.5As a CX specialist using Flowgear, I find it efficiently integrates third-party data into Salesforce, automates manual processes, and reduces staffing needs. While implementation is simple and scalable, the user interface could use improvement. We haven't considered other solutions.
